Nasturtium Tom Thumb Alaska Mix Seeds grow into compact, colorful plants admired for their vibrant blooms and decorative variegated leaves. These easy-to-grow flowers are perfect for edging, borders and container gardens, adding cheerful colour throughout the season. Nasturtiums perform best in sunny locations and require minimal care, making them ideal for beginner gardeners. Their flowers also attract pollinators, enhancing garden biodiversity.

Frequently Asked Questions

Does Tom Thumb nasturtium grow differently than standard nasturtium varieties?

Tom Thumb stays compact and bushy, unlike taller, trailing nasturtium types that spread further across garden beds.

Why do Alaska Mix nasturtium leaves look speckled or marbled?

This variety's leaves naturally show cream-and-green variegation, a decorative trait distinct from plain green nasturtium foliage.

Does soil fertility affect how much this nasturtium blooms?

Nasturtiums often bloom more heavily in leaner soil, since overly rich soil can encourage foliage growth over flowering.

Can Tom Thumb Alaska Mix seeds be saved for replanting next year?

Seeds can often be collected and saved, though mixed varieties may not always produce identical color results the following year.

How long does it take for this nasturtium to flower after planting?

It typically germinates and blooms within several weeks under warm conditions, making it a fast-growing seasonal option.

Is this nasturtium mix better suited to formal or informal garden styles?

Its casual, spilling growth habit and mixed colors suit informal, cottage-style plantings more than tightly structured formal beds.
